Yakni is a Hindi term for mutton

Related Articles

Ghee ■■
Indian: NeyiGhee is a Hindi word that refers to clarified butterIt is made from farm Fresh Milk under . . . Read More
Chilgoze ■■
Chilgoze refers to a small and long creamy nuts with brown shells used in cooking or eaten raw. It is . . . Read More